 a-kzx Title: What do we know about Efficiency\, Effectiveness and Impact o
 f Education and Research?Abstract: Education and research are two very imp
 ortant sectors for the development and growth of people\, institutions and
  countries. Their relevance and complexity have attracted the attention of
  different disciplines to try to understand how they work and how it is po
 ssible to measure their performance. In this seminar\, by presenting the l
 ines of research in which I contributed starting from my Ph.D. Thesis on '
 Comparative Efficiency and Productivity Analysis based on Nonparametric an
 d Robust Nonparametric Methods. Methodology and Applications”\, I will mak
 e a state of the art of our knowledge on these topics. It will emerge the 
 importance of having a framework for the development of metrics\, necessar
 y to be able to evaluate their robustness. I will show how crucial is the 
 interdependence between theoretical hypotheses\, methodological aspects an
 d data properties to achieve consistent empirical results and robust evalu
 ations. I will present my main methodological research\, moving from condi
 tional multidimensional measures with application to the case of European 
 universities rankings\, up to the development of statistical tests for two
 -stage efficiency models. I will then review the works carried out during 
 some interdisciplinary research projects aimed at creating Sapientia\, the
  Ontology of the multidisciplinary research evaluation\, and the integrati
 on of different databases on research and teaching\, including some result
 s obtained with the application of statistical techniques developed in phy
 sics for complex systems. Finally\, I will outline my current methodologic
 al research in progress and some results on evaluating evaluations\, inclu
 ding the use of normative ethics for building “good” evaluations and the i
 nvestigation of the conceptual problems connected to the assessment of “me
